Volle Kanne - FAQs
When did Volle Kanne first air on ZDF?
Volle Kanne premiered on August 30, 1999, on the German public broadcaster ZDF. It has been airing continuously ever since, making it one of Germany's longest-running daily morning shows with over two and a half decades of uninterrupted broadcasting.
How many seasons and episodes does Volle Kanne have?
Volle Kanne has aired 26 seasons comprising a remarkable 5,875 episodes in total. Each season typically contains between 158 and 246 episodes, reflecting the show's daily broadcast schedule across the year on ZDF.
Is Volle Kanne still airing or has it ended?
Volle Kanne is still actively in production and continues to air as a returning series on ZDF. As of 2025, the show remains in its 26th season, confirming its status as one of German public television's most enduring daily programmes.
Who are the main hosts of Volle Kanne?
Volle Kanne has featured a rotating roster of well-known German personalities. Key figures include Susanne Stichler, who serves as a regular host, alongside frequent guests and contributors such as Andrea Kiewel, Nadine Krüger, Florian Weiss, Maite Kelly, and Atze Schröder.
What network airs Volle Kanne in Germany?
Volle Kanne airs exclusively on ZDF, one of Germany's two major public-service broadcasters. The show has been a staple of ZDF's morning programming since its debut in 1999, delivering daily service, lifestyle, and entertainment content to German-speaking audiences.
